When to use dye to polished concrete: Dye manufacturers typically propose making use of dye with the grit degree just ahead of the ultimate polishing move then implementing densifier afterward. However, Bob Harris, writer of Bob Harris' Guideline to Polished Concrete Flooring, says he has experienced good accomplishment applying dye within the 400-grit stage and after the slab has become densified, given that dyes are soluble and may penetrate readily.

Charges for polished concrete will vary by location, sq. footage, preparing essential, along with the complexity in the challenge and design and style selections; however, you can expect to pay for among $3 and $12 per sq. foot.

That concrete flooring feels cold underfoot is commonly reported as its important downside, and it is true that concrete won't retain heat, so when your own home starts obtaining cold in winter, the floor will much too.
